Limbic System
Part of the brain involved with emotions and olfaction; includes the cingulate gyrus, hippocampus, habenular nuclei, parts of the basal ganglia, the hypothalamus (especially the mammillary bodies, the olfactory cortex, and various nerve tracts).
Sensory Input
Information received by the sensory organs and transmitted to the brain.
Parietal Lobe
A region of the cerebral cortex involved in processing sensory information related to touch, pressure, temperature, and spatial orientation.
